About Us
Established in 1998, ÉireComposites operates an accredited composites design, manufacturing and testing facility in Inverin, Galway. With over 60 employees, we have the experience, depth expertise and knowledge supplying into aviation, space, renewables and mobility sectors.
ÉireComposites is dedicated to improving society through the commercialisation of cutting-edge research on composite materials.
